Wood-based panels - Determination of performance characteristics for load bearing panels for use in floors, roofs and walls
This European Standard specifies:
- concentrated load test and assessment methods for floor and roof decking;
- soft body impact assessment methods and classification system for floors, roofs and walls.
This European Standard does not include racking testing or uniformly distributed loads as these are covered by testing according to EN 594 or calculation according to EN 1995-1-1 respectively.
This European Standard specifies the procedure for determining the performance characteristics through type testing, of load-bearing wood-based panels fitted on:
a) structural joists for decking:
1) in flooring applications in load categories A, B, C and D;
2) in roof applications in load categories H and I;
for which type testing involves:
i) punching shear under concentrated loading;
ii) vertical soft body impact;
b) studs for walling application for which type testing involves:
1) pendular soft body impact.
Annex A (normative) lists modifications to EN 1195, particularly the contact area of the loading head that may be used for concentrated loading.
Annex B (informative) provides proposals for national performance requirements.
Annex C (informative) provides examples for a decking application in a floor and a roof.

Overview
EN 12871:2013 - "Wood-based panels - Determination of performance characteristics for load bearing panels for use in floors, roofs and walls" (CEN) defines type‑testing methods and assessment criteria for load-bearing wood-based panels used as decking and wall sheathing. The standard specifies procedures to determine performance characteristics under concentrated load and soft body impact, and provides a classification system for impact performance. EN 12871:2013 is focused on type testing of specific constructions rather than general racking or uniformly distributed load testing (those are covered by EN 594 and EN 1995‑1‑1).
Key topics and technical requirements
- Scope of testing
- Decking on structural joists (flooring load categories A–D; roofing load categories H–I).
- Wall sheathing on studs (pendular soft body impact).
- Test methods
- Punching shear under concentrated loading (concentrated load test for floor/roof decking).
- Vertical soft body impact for decking; pendular soft body impact for wall sheathing.
- Performance characteristics evaluated
- Stiffness characteristics (serviceability limit state) for concentrated loads.
- Serviceability load corresponding to the elasticity limit.
- Fmax,k (characteristic maximum force) for ultimate limit state.
- Impact Class (three classes defined for soft body impact performance).
- Type testing approach
- Results apply to a specific panel design and installation configuration.
- Statistical evaluation references EN 1058 (characteristic 5‑percentile and mean values).
- Annexes
- Annex A (normative): modifications to EN 1195, including the contact area / loading head (load pad now 50 mm × 50 mm).
- Annex B (informative): proposals for national performance requirements (includes a reduction factor for ULS and span adjustments for roof slope).
- Annex C (informative): worked examples for floor and roof decking.

3.1 service class 1 service class 1 is characterised by a moisture content in the materials corresponding to a temperature of 20 °C and the relative humidity of the surrounding air only exceeding 65 % for a few weeks per year [SOURCE: EN 1995-1-1:2004, 2.3.1.3] 3.2 service class 2 service class 2 is characterised by a moisture content in the materials corresponding to a temperature of 20 °C and the relative humidity of the surrounding air only exceeding 85 % for a few weeks per year [SOURCE: EN 1995-1-1:2004, 2.3.1.3] 3.3 service class 3 service class 3 is characterised by climatic conditions leading to higher moisture contents than in service class 2 [SOURCE: EN 1995-1-1:2004, 2.3.1.3] SIST EN 12871:2013
Note 1 to entry: The load values are defined in the National Annexes to EN 1991-1-1 or, where not available, in EN 1991-1-1. 3.8 structural wall-sheathing vertical (or quasi-vertical) assembly of wood-based panels, supported by studs, capable of taking up loading in the 3 directions of space 3.9 structural floor-decking horizontal (or quasi-horizontal) assembly of wood-based panels fixed to supporting joists and spanning over them Note 1 to entry: When a load is applied on the decking, it is free to deflect between the joists. 3.10 sub-floor structural panel meant to be covered by overlays 3.11 structural roof-decking usually, sloping assembly of wood based panels, fixed to supporting joists and spanning over them Note 1 to entry: Roof assemblies are tested horizontally. Note 2 to entry: When a load is applied on the decking, it is free to deflect between the joists. SIST EN 12871:2013
3.13 cold roof roof design in which the panels and some of the supporting joists are placed above the insulation Note 1 to entry: Usually, the panels are considered to be under conditions corresponding to service class 2.
3.14 set irreversible deformation (unevenness between two adjoining panels) of the test floor, wall or roof after the removal of the applied load 3.15 punching shear strength stress in the section of a panel under a concentrated load applied perpendicularly to its face by means of a loading head with a specified cross section 4 Symbols and subscripts 4.1 Symbols A Contact area of a square load pad F Force applied to the component being tested L Span between joists or studs (axis to axis distance) with horizontal test assembly L.
